À propos de la chanson

La chanson évoque le profond sentiment de solitude qui s’installe après un départ déchirant. La narratrice se retrouve entourée de gens, mais elle ne perçoit rien d’autre que le battement de son cœur, symbolisant son chagrin. Elle se rend compte que tenter d’autres relations ne comblera pas le vide laissé par celui ou celle qu’elle a perdu(e), chaque caresse et chaque mot de douceur évoquant des souvenirs inoubliables. Cette réflexion sur la perte et l’absence révèle à quel point l'amour véritable est unique et irremplaçable. Le cœur de l’artiste crie sa douleur, insistant sur le fait que personne ne peut remplir l'espace laissé par un être cher.
